Abstract:
Introducing graphic representations of the concepts presented in class can help the student to analyze the relationships between concepts. In this sense, it has been proven that graphic representations such concept maps are easier to follow than oral or written presentations. In addition, the active participation of students in the realization of these types of maps promotes meaningful learning.

In this paper, authors introduce an ongoing Educational Innovation Project (EIP) that is being carried out at the Faculty of Engineering of Bilbao of the University of the Basque Country (Spain). During the first master's course, students handle large amounts of information in electronic format through the web. The aim of this project is to investigate the effectiveness of using concept maps enriched with hyperlinks a navigating tool for accessing electronic study materials in Moodle and other websites. CmapTools software has been used in order to develop the different concept maps.

We have observed that the students have not sufficiently understood the relationships between the concepts worked on in previous courses and this makes it very difficult to learn new knowledge. For this reason, it is especially important to help students identify which gaps they have. This pedagogical tool can serve as a kind of “internet road map” to develop solid and well-structured knowledge and would also be a very useful tool in the autonomous learning of new concepts.
